Well, what can I say?! Simply the best accommodation I have stayed in over the years. Extremely clean, friendly and just wonderful from start to finish. The staff are very approachable and polite, Giulio in the breakfast bar is very obliging, efficient and a credit to the hotel. There wasn't much information online about this hotel but it's a collection of 13 suites and villas, some with private pools and some with hot tubs. There is a communal pool which is rarely busy, with sun beds and deck chairs around it. We stayed in a 3 bedroom villa meant for 6 (but we were only 3) - there were two large doubles, a large single room and a sofa bed. Kitchen was clean and well-equipped, mini bar prices are high so I would advise going up the road to the OK! Mart to buy your drinks. It's a short walk only, max 5 mins even if you walk slow and it's hot. Masoutes is down the road in the other direction and perhaps offers a bit more choice. Location is great but if you're coming from the south side, you'll likely miss it as it's only well-signposted for those coming from the north (which is the best way from the airport). It's a bit hidden from the road but not secluded at all. Felt safe there at all times. Lots of good eateries close by, even walking distance. Highly recommend - Andreas and Maria which is 3 mins walk away. The only small improvement is that I wish there was a washing machine in the villa. Breakfast was absolutely wonderful with fresh orange juice and teas/coffees - the selection of fresh fruit, pastries, cakes and choice of eggs varied every day and was delightful. Otherwise a perfect family getaway... We will be back!

It’s such a shame, this was the end to our holiday. Whilst the Villa was large and spacious. The sofa bed was not comfortable at all. ||The breakfast was limited, no menu to know what you’re getting. Basically, egg, bread, fruit and cheeses al la carte. No other hot food, or toast. Service was slow. We left after the eggs were served as nothing else came out and no one even noticed us at all. To even check how we were. Only one person servicing the entire restaurant. Poor chap. This is not worth the price. It says full breakfast included but you have to pay €5 euros extra for a Latte? Yet it says breakfast included. We’ve had better breakfasts at a much lower price. ||There was no water in the room, you had to pay. You had two nespresso pods for coffee but no milk or cream. ||The pool jets didn’t all work. We later asked for some ice from the room service and said they were too busy! ||Not for €340 per night your not! ||Couldn’t do late check out||Transfer service says free on website yet we paid €35 euros from Port to Villa and then €35 euros from Villa to airport which isn’t far at all. This is well overpriced. ||Didn’t seem to care that we didn’t have a great experience. Upon check out, when we were asked. Said it was just ok, not great or anything and they weren’t bothered. ||The two owners, didn’t acknowledge or speak. Not a good impression. ||No carry to room luggage service, despite two flights of stairs. Other hotels do this easily. ||I’ve been coming to Greece for over 13 years and this is a most disappointing experience. ||Wouldn’t pay this amount of money again for a one night...

This property is amazing! We stayed in a two bedroom Villa with a private pool. It was gorgeous! We also had a smaller bedroom with a twin bed. Each of the three rooms had a full bathroom (the smaller bedroom had a smaller bathroom, but still a full bath). The suite had a full kitchen, dining room, living room, outdoor patio with dining table, and a private outdoor pool. We were also close to the hotel pool, which was lovely. ||Breakfast was included in the rate, and it could be either delivered to the room or served at their super cute restaurant on the outdoor covered patio. The food was divine, but what stood out even more was the service. Renia took care of us every day, and she was such a delight. She is genuine and seems to truly enjoy connecting with the guests. Benjamin was also fantastic. He assisted us with dinner recommendations and reservations, and we loved his suggestions. ||We wish we had been able to take advantage of the in-room spa services they offer, but we wanted to spend time at the beach and in town. We did enjoy the hotel pool, though. It is well maintained and offers full bar service from their restaurant. Loved the floating bean bags!||The hotel team was very accommodating with scheduling transfers for us (we wish we had asked about the local bus schedule - may have been cheaper). ||All in all, it was an incredible experience!
